The legacy homegrown job queue at Ferrowork has been replaced by the Conveyly task service, and all enqueue calls should now target its REST endpoint. Jobs are submitted as JSON payloads with a type, priority, and idempotency token; duplicate tokens within 24 hours are silently dropped. Polling is no longer supported — register a callback instead. For contractor access during onboarding, requests are authorized against the internal gateway using the key below:

service key, fawip-bajef: kto11_Qt5wZK9vdNC

### Step 2: GC Tuning for Threadmark Matcher

Threadmark 5.0 changes the default collector. Plugins holding large match graphs will see longer pauses unless the heap regions are resized. Pin your plugin's allocation rate below the documented ceiling and test against the staging matcher. Apply the settings that follow before upgrading.

settings of fafog-haduf:
ZORIX_PIN=4648
ZORIX_METRICS_HOST=metrics.zorix.paliqsys.corp
ZORIX_LOG_LEVEL=info
ZORIX_TENANT=druix

MEMO — Kettling Depot Receiving

Uniform sets for the new Kettling depot arrive Wednesday via Ashgrove courier: 40 boxes, sorted by size, manifest attached to box one. Check the count at the dock before signing; shortages go straight to stores, not the courier. The hand-over instruction the courier will follow is set out below.

drop instructions, tafof-baguf: the holmir gilox courier leaves the sormir ulaok holdor ledger at gate 5596 under passcode 257343

Meeting notes, 3rd sprint review — PackSift scanner.

Decided: ship homoglyph detection behind a flag. Registry diff job moves to hourly. False-positive allowlist frozen until the scoring rework lands. No new heuristics before then. Maintainers: keep the corpus snapshots; we'll need them for regression checks. Single point of accountability for the scanner is recorded below.

approver of bagug-bagag = Holael Pramir